The Global Positioning System (GPS)

Among geopositioning technologies, the Global Positioning System (GPS) stands out as one of the most recognized and widely used. GPS employs a constellation of satellites orbiting Earth to deliver precise location and time information to users on or near the Earth's surface.

Understanding Geopositioning Systems

Geopositioning relies on various satellite-based systems beyond just GPS:

  1. GLONASS: Russia's counterpart to GPS.
  2. Galileo: The European Union's global navigation satellite system.
  3. BeiDou: China's navigation system that also supports regional coverage.

These systems collectively enhance global navigational capabilities through interoperability.
